Cloth, G. 208pp, b/w illustrations, cheap paper rather tanned, head & tail of the spine worn, Ex Cruising Association Library copy with their bookplate & gilt stamp to the upper cover, a fair copy. A collection of humorous short stories, some with a nautical aspect. Alfred Walter Barrett [ 1869 - c1933 ] journalist & author who published many books using the pseudonym R Andom. He was taken to court in June 1921 and found guilty of conspiring to corrupt public morals - he had published a lonely hearts magazine intended to allow lonely peiple find friendship. Some found more than that, the judge, in sentencing Barrett said - 'There can be no graver attack on the morals of this country than to establish a paper as you did for the purpose of allowing men and women to commit immorality.' This was Barrett's last published work - the hard labour to which he was sentenced perhaps sealing his fate. 300 grams.
